RKA Adds New Position

Alderete will serve as VP of supply, transportation
ROMULUS, Mich. -- RKA Petroleum Cos. Inc., a leader in the fuel transportation and services industry, has added Brian Alderete as its vice president of supply and transportation. This is a new position for RKA as a result of growth delivering fuel to its commercial, government and retail customers.

In his position, Alderete oversees all aspects of RKA's transportation division, including that of RKA's sister company, Rex Petroleum Cos. Inc.

Alderate's strong background in both the fuel and the transportation industries adds more than 15 years of experience to the [image-nocss] company. Most recently he served as vice president of supply and logistics for Fleet Card Fuels and Nikolaus Tank Lines in Bakersfield, Calif.

Alderate's resume also includes holding professional leadership positions at Pan Pacific Petroleum Co. Inc., Wholesale Fuels Inc., and USA Transport, all located in California.

"RKA required additional high-level management to meet the demands of our increasing transportation needs, to better serve our fast-growing customer base," said Rick Enright, president. "RKA is an extremely strong, customer-focused business, and this is critical to our continued success as a service organization."

Romulus, Mich.-based RKA distributes refined and renewable fuel products and provides fuel management solutions to commercial, industrial and government customers in 24 states. RKA serves the retail industry in Florida, Michigan and Ohio. Rex Carriers Inc., Romulus, offers logistics management throughout 24 states and Ontario, Canada. Land & Sea Petroleum Holdings Inc., Fort Lauderdale, Fla., distributes refined fuel products in Florida.
